diff -rauN gcr/gck/meson.build gcr-no-vala-patch/gck/meson.build --- gcr/gck/meson.build 2021-05-13 11:42:03.269748891 +0200 +++ gcr-no-vala-patch/gck/meson.build 2021-05-13 11:37:10.000000000 +0200 @@ -142,16 +142,16 @@ install: true, ) - gck_vapi = gnome.generate_vapi('gck-@0@'.format(gck_major_version), - sources: gck_gir[0], - metadata_dirs: meson.current_source_dir(), - packages: [ 'glib-2.0', 'gio-2.0' ], - install: true, - ) +# gck_vapi = gnome.generate_vapi('gck-@0@'.format(gck_major_version), +# sources: gck_gir[0], +# metadata_dirs: meson.current_source_dir(), +# packages: [ 'glib-2.0', 'gio-2.0' ], +# install: true, +# ) - install_data('pkcs11.vapi', - install_dir: get_option('datadir') / 'vala' / 'vapi', - ) +# install_data('pkcs11.vapi', +# install_dir: get_option('datadir') / 'vala' / 'vapi', +# ) endif # pkg-config file diff -rauN gcr/gcr/meson.build gcr-no-vala-patch/gcr/meson.build --- gcr/gcr/meson.build 2021-05-13 11:42:03.336415608 +0200 +++ gcr-no-vala-patch/gcr/meson.build 2021-05-13 11:37:47.000000000 +0200 @@ -204,18 +204,18 @@ install: true, ) - gcr_vapi = gnome.generate_vapi('gcr-@0@'.format(gcr_major_version), - sources: gcr_gir[0], - packages: [ 'glib-2.0', 'gio-2.0', gck_vapi ], - metadata_dirs: meson.current_source_dir(), - vapi_dirs: [ - build_root / 'gck', - ], - gir_dirs: [ - build_root / 'gck', - ], - install: true, - ) +# gcr_vapi = gnome.generate_vapi('gcr-@0@'.format(gcr_major_version), +# sources: gcr_gir[0], +# packages: [ 'glib-2.0', 'gio-2.0', gck_vapi ], +# metadata_dirs: meson.current_source_dir(), +# vapi_dirs: [ +# build_root / 'gck', +# ], +# gir_dirs: [ +# build_root / 'gck', +# ], +# install: true, +# ) endif # pkg-config file diff -rauN gcr/ui/meson.build gcr-no-vala-patch/ui/meson.build --- gcr/ui/meson.build 2021-05-13 11:42:03.309748920 +0200 +++ gcr-no-vala-patch/ui/meson.build 2021-05-13 11:38:21.000000000 +0200 @@ -168,26 +168,26 @@ install: true, ) - gcr_ui_vapi = gnome.generate_vapi('gcr-ui-@0@'.format(gcr_major_version), - sources: gcr_ui_gir[0], - packages: [ - 'glib-2.0', - 'gio-2.0', - gck_vapi, - gcr_vapi, - 'gtk+-3.0' - ], - metadata_dirs: meson.current_source_dir(), - vapi_dirs: [ - build_root / 'gck', - build_root / 'gcr', - ], - gir_dirs: [ - build_root / 'gck', - build_root / 'gcr', - ], - install: true, - ) +# gcr_ui_vapi = gnome.generate_vapi('gcr-ui-@0@'.format(gcr_major_version), +# sources: gcr_ui_gir[0], +# packages: [ +# 'glib-2.0', +# 'gio-2.0', +# gck_vapi, +# gcr_vapi, +# 'gtk+-3.0' +# ], +# metadata_dirs: meson.current_source_dir(), +# vapi_dirs: [ +# build_root / 'gck', +# build_root / 'gcr', +# ], +# gir_dirs: [ +# build_root / 'gck', +# build_root / 'gcr', +# ], +# install: true, +# ) endif # gcr-viewer